summaryrefslogtreecommitdiff
path: root/java/test/Ice/exceptions/run.py
diff options
context:
space:
mode:
authorBernard Normier <bernard@zeroc.com>2004-05-06 01:09:57 +0000
committerBernard Normier <bernard@zeroc.com>2004-05-06 01:09:57 +0000
commit7b707395300fcf7615fc0d38e7cf4f7fe4d0d7d4 (patch)
tree68f58388b3971cd6238d220d0dba0a99f0d4cbc4 /java/test/Ice/exceptions/run.py
parentfix in OA::deactivate() (diff)
downloadice-7b707395300fcf7615fc0d38e7cf4f7fe4d0d7d4.tar.bz2
ice-7b707395300fcf7615fc0d38e7cf4f7fe4d0d7d4.tar.xz
ice-7b707395300fcf7615fc0d38e7cf4f7fe4d0d7d4.zip
Switched back to popen (from popen4)
Diffstat (limited to 'java/test/Ice/exceptions/run.py')
-rwxr-xr-xjava/test/Ice/exceptions/run.py8
1 files changed, 3 insertions, 5 deletions
diff --git a/java/test/Ice/exceptions/run.py b/java/test/Ice/exceptions/run.py
index 456e532004d..5f6c6bb40fb 100755
--- a/java/test/Ice/exceptions/run.py
+++ b/java/test/Ice/exceptions/run.py
@@ -41,20 +41,18 @@ client = "java -ea Client --Ice.ProgramName=Client "
print "starting server...",
classpath = os.getenv("CLASSPATH", "")
os.environ["CLASSPATH"] = os.path.join(testdirAMD, "classes") + TestUtil.sep + classpath
-(serverPipeIn, serverPipe) = os.popen4(server + TestUtil.serverOptions)
+serverPipe = os.popen(server + TestUtil.serverOptions + " 2>&1")
TestUtil.getAdapterReady(serverPipe)
print "ok"
print "starting client...",
classpath = os.getenv("CLASSPATH", "")
os.environ["CLASSPATH"] = os.path.join(testdir, "classes") + TestUtil.sep + classpath
-(clientPipeIn, clientPipe) = os.popen4(client + TestUtil.clientOptions)
+clientPipe = os.popen(client + TestUtil.clientOptions + " 2>&1")
print "ok"
TestUtil.printOutputFromPipe(clientPipe)
-clientInStatus = clientPipeIn.close()
clientStatus = clientPipe.close()
-serverInStatus = serverPipeIn.close()
serverStatus = serverPipe.close()
-if clientInStatus or serverInStatus:
+if clientStatus or serverStatus:
TestUtil.killServers()
sys.exit(1)